大一学习内容

一,本学期python基础学习历程

1. 学习利用Pyecharts绘图:

Pyecharts 是一个基于 Echarts 的 Python 可视化库,支持各种类型的交互式图表,如折线图、柱状图、散点图等。学习使用 Pyecharts 可以通过简单的 Python 代码生成复杂的图表,展示数据分析结果。

2. Lambda定义匿名函数:

Lambda 函数是一种匿名函数,允许你快速定义简单的函数,通常用于需要一个函数,但只用一次的情况。它们的语法简洁,可以在不使用 def 语句定义函数的情况下创建函数对象。

3. 类型注释:

类型注释是 Python 3.5 引入的功能,允许开发者在变量、函数参数和函数返回值等地方添加类型信息。这些注释不影响代码的运行,但可以提供更好的可读性和静态类型检查支持。

4. 多态:

多态是面向对象编程的一个重要概念,指同一个方法调用可以根据对象的不同而具有不同的表现形式。Python 中通过继承和方法重写实现多态。

5. 闭包:

闭包是指可以访问其定义域外部变量的函数。在 Python 中,闭包通常通过函数内部定义函数并返回的方式实现,内部函数可以访问外部函数的局部变量。

6. 设计模式:

设计模式是解决特定问题的经验总结,提供了面向对象设计中常见问题的解决方案。常见的设计模式包括工厂模式、单例模式、策略模式等,它们有助于提高代码的可维护性和可扩展性。

7. 多线程编程:

多线程编程是利用多个线程并发执行来提高程序性能的技术。在 Python 中,可以使用内置的 threading 模块来创建和管理线程,实现并行执行任务。

8. 递归:

递归是一种通过调用自身来解决问题的方法。在 Python 中,递归函数调用自身直到达到基本条件,适合解决一些分而治之的问题,如树遍历、阶乘计算等。

9. 类:

类是面向对象编程的基本单位,用于封装数据和方法。Python 中的类通过 class 关键字定义,支持继承、多态和封装等面向对象编程的特性。

10. 装饰器:

装饰器是一种高阶函数,用于修改其他函数的行为。在 Python 中,装饰器可以在不改变函数代码的情况下增强函数功能,如日志记录、性能测试等。

二,机器学习理论

机器学习,作为人工智能的重要分支,深深吸引了我。在理论学习的过程中,我体会到了许多深刻的感悟。

首先,机器学习不仅仅是一种技术,更是一种思维方式的转变。它教会了我如何从数据中提取模式和洞见,而不是依赖人为规则的硬编码。这种数据驱动的思维方式,能够帮助我们更好地理解和解决复杂的现实世界问题。

其次,机器学习让我深刻认识到算法的重要性。不同的算法在不同的问题上表现迥异,选择合适的算法对于问题的解决至关重要。而且,算法的优化和调参是一个反复实验和推敲的过程,需要不断地尝试和学习。

另外,机器学习的学习过程也锻炼了我的数学建模能力。理解和推导机器学习模型背后的数学原理,不仅增加了对算法本质的理解,也提升了解决实际问题的能力。

最重要的是,机器学习教会了我持续学习和不断进步的重要性。由于技术的快速发展和新算法的不断涌现,要保持竞争力就必须保持学习的状态,随时掌握最新的进展和技术。

机器学习作为人工智能的核心技术之一,已经在各个领域展示了巨大的潜力和影响力。我通过深入探讨机器学习的基础理论和现代应用,分析其在解决实际问题中的作用和挑战。首先,我回顾了机器学习的起源和发展历程,探讨了经典的监督学习、无监督学习和强化学习算法,并分析了它们的基本原理及适用场景。随后,我们重点讨论了深度学习技术的兴起和革命性进展,探索了深度神经网络在计算机视觉、自然语言处理和推荐系统等领域的成功应用。

本文还深入研究了机器学习模型的评估与优化方法,包括交叉验证、超参数调优和模型解释性分析,以及面临的挑战和解决方案。特别地,我关注了数据质量、过拟合和泛化能力等问题,探讨了如何在实际应用中有效地应对这些挑战。

最后,我在机器学习理论学习带来的深刻感悟和未来的发展方向。强调了持续学习和实践在掌握机器学习技术中的重要性,认识到在技术快速发展的背景下,理论与实践的结合是推动机器学习应用进步的关键。

综上所述,机器学习不仅是一门技术,更是一种思想的革新和实践的探索。通过深入学习和实践,我对机器学习的理解不断加深,相信在未来的实际应用中,这些感悟将成为我不可或缺的宝贵财富

三,深度学习方向

下面的是我找的一些方向,以及他们的应用。

  1. 基于深度学习的自然语言处理应用:

    • 题目: “基于深度学习的情感分析在社交媒体数据上的应用”
    • 内容: 使用深度学习模型如LSTM或Transformer,探索情感分析在社交媒体文本数据中的精确度和实用性。
  2. 深度学习在医学影像分析中的应用:

    • 题目: “基于深度学习的医学图像分割与疾病诊断”
    • 内容: 研究深度学习方法在医学影像中自动识别和分割病变区域的能力,以及其在临床诊断中的实际应用。
  3. 生成对抗网络(GAN)的进展与应用:

    • 题目: “生成对抗网络的进展与图像合成应用”
    • 内容: 分析生成对抗网络在图像生成、风格迁移和超分辨率重建等领域的最新进展,探索其在艺术创作和设计中的潜力。
  4. 深度学习在金融市场预测中的应用:

    • 题目: “基于深度学习的股票市场预测与交易策略”
    • 内容: 使用深度学习模型预测股票价格走势,探索其在量化交易和金融决策支持中的应用。
  5. 深度强化学习在智能系统中的应用:

    • 题目: “基于深度强化学习的智能游戏代理”
    • 内容: 研究深度强化学习算法在视频游戏中的应用,分析其在游戏智能化和自动化测试方面的效果。
  6. 自动驾驶系统中的深度学习技术:

    • 题目: “深度学习在自动驾驶决策中的应用与安全性分析”
    • 内容: 探索深度学习在自动驾驶汽车中的感知、决策和控制方面的应用,以及其在实际道路环境中的安全性评估。
  7. 面向边缘计算的深度学习模型优化:

    • 题目: “面向边缘计算的深度学习模型优化与部署”
    • 内容: 研究如何优化和部署深度学习模型,以适应资源受限的边缘计算设备,如IoT设备和移动端应用。

这些方向涵盖了深度学习在不同领域中的应用,我在未来会根据自己的兴趣和目标选择一个或结合多个方面进行深入研究和探索。
————————————————

                        版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。

原文链接:https://blog.csdn.net/2401_84926758/article/details/139777253

  • 36
    点赞
  • 27
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值